407 Integra® Bladder Pump
P/N 11439
Solinst IntegraŽ Bladder pumps come in PVC or Stainless Steel. Every pump allows consistent, high quality samples in all types of applications. It offers excellent
performance and reliability. With Integra Bladder Pumps there
is the assurance that there is no air/water contact during
sampling. It meets the most rigorous US EPA standards for
VOC groundwater monitoring.
The bladder ensures that drive air or gas does not contact
the sample, thus avoiding degassing or contamination of the
sample. Integra Pumps are rugged and long lasting. TeflonŽ
bladders are ideal for dedication, while less expensive
polyethylene bladders are available for those that prefer to
change bladders after each use. Bladders and intake filters are
easily replaced in the field in just a few minutes. No special
tools required. Excellent for either regular flow or low flow sampling, the stainless
steel pumps can lift from depths up to 500 ft (150 m) below grade.
The PVC Integra operates up to 100 ft (30 m) below grade.

Benefits
High Quality Samples: Consistently accurate samples with excellent VOC sample integrity.
Simplicity:The controller, air compressor and flow-through
cell can be easily transported by one person to any site.
Hookup to the pump is by compression fittings. Low purge
volumes ensure rapid sampling.
Bladders: Durable Teflon bladders are ideal for dedication.
Inexpensive polyethylene is also available.
Cost Savings: Reduced need for repeat sampling and shorter time required for each sampling round.
Features
Stainless Steel or Low Cost PVC: 1.66” Ø (42 mm) and 1” Ø (25 mm) in 316 stainless steel. 1.66” Ø (42 mm) in PVC.
.Non-Vertical Applications: Pumps operate effectively at almost any angle and can be placed under landfills, tailings, storage tanks or contaminant plumes.
Leachate/Product Pumping: Pneumatic drive pumps are well suited for pumping contaminant liquids. Strong solvents and corrosive chemicals can be easily and economically pumped.
Survives Dry Pumping, Dirty Air and Sand: Integra bladders are not damaged by operation in sediment laden water, or in dry pumping conditions
Freeze Protection Kit: Optional accessory available to prevent freezing in the sample line.
